STAR TREK: TNG “VIRAL – BACTERIOLOGICAL SCANNER” FROM “SHADES OF GRAY”

Record summary

A prop medical device featured in the Star Trek: The Next Generation episode “Shades of Gray”. The item appeared in sickbay scenes taking place while “Commander Riker” (Jonathan Frakes) was infected with a virulent agent. The item is molded resin with a molded resin sensor ring in the center that also mounts a lighted node on a trio of metal supports. The hand grip features a switch and button to activate internally mounted electronic features. The item is powered by two banks of AAA sized 1.5volt batteries with soldiered leads. At the time of location the batteries had been stored for a number of years and were thus removed. A photograph of the lesser or the corroded banks indicates the powering configuration but batteries are not included. The item measures approx. 9.5 X 5 X 1.75 inches.
